This manual is an outcome of the project “#JeSuisWoman’’, a Training Course organized by iDEMO Institute for democracy, which was supported by the European Commission through the KA 1 “Learning mobility of individuals” within the Erasmus+ programme.
This manual is a practical toolkit for volunteers, youth workers and other non-formal learning practitioners who aim to work on the topics of gender based violence, gender equality, gender based discrimination, refugees, intercultural learning and inclusion; or a combination of any of the mentioned topics. It enables the readers to explore and understand different aspects of the topic and to gain knowledge needed for designing and implementing non formal learning activities.
It contains a set of tools, activities and methods as well as theoretical inputs and references for the future work in the field. This manual includes activities which were implemented during the training course and most of them are flexible to adapt to particular needs of specific target group. The manual has been structured by following typical program flow in any non-formal learning activity.
In the beginning there are icebreakers and other get-to-know-each-other methods followed
by team building activities. It continues with methods within the field of human rights protection, intercultural learning and gender equality followed by methods used for assessment and evaluation.
It concludes with flipcharts needed to provide theoretical input and handouts.
The manual also contains results of the social campain "Women of Europe" implemented during the TC.
